Web27 aug. 2013 · Mitral annular calcification (MAC) is defined as chronic degeneration of the mitral valve fibrous ring involving mainly the posterior annulus. This disorder is common in the elderly, particularly in women. 1 MAC may occur in younger patients with advanced renal disease or other metabolic disorders that result in abnormal calcium metabolism.
